Day 4: Day Trip Adventure

Kyoto, Japan

7:00AM

Breakfast at Bakery Otonari

Enjoy freshly baked bread and pastries at this local favorite before your day trip.
JPY800, 30 minutes

8:00AM

Travel to Nara

Take the Kintetsu Line to Nara for a refreshing day to see the famous deer park and historical sites.
JPY900, 1 hour

9:30AM

Nara Park

Visit the incredible Nara Park where you can see free-roaming deer and enjoy the beautiful nature.
Free, 2 hours

11:30AM

Todai-ji Temple

Marvel at the enormous Great Buddha statue housed within this historical temple.
JPY600, 1 hour

1:00PM

Lunch at Maguro Koya

Savor a fresh sushi meal from this renowned local eatery, perfect for seafood lovers.
JPY2500, 1 hour

2:30PM

Kasuga-taisha Shrine

Visit this ancient shrine, known for its many stone lanterns in a serene forest setting.
Free, 1.5 hours

4:00PM

Return to Kyoto

Take the Kintetsu Line back to Kyoto.
JPY900, 1 hour

5:30PM

Dinner at Nanzan Giro Giro

Dine in this outstanding kaiseki restaurant known for its creative presentation and harmony of flavors.
JPY6500, 2 hours
